Is this a franchise?
We call it a partnership: you license the Futurum curriculum, training and brand, with ongoing support from Singapore. The structure is agreed partner by partner.
How much does it cost?
There is no one-size-fits-all number — the shape depends on your city and your plan. On the first call we walk through the structure together, openly.
Do I need to be an educator?
The campus needs educators; the partner needs conviction and operating ability. Many strong partners pair an operator with a lead teacher.
Has this been done before?
Yes — the model has already crossed borders once: our first campus outside Singapore runs the same curriculum to the same standard as the six at home.
How fast can I open?
As fast as your city allows and no faster than the training does — the timeline is planned together in step four, not promised in a headline.
Can I start with one campus?
Every partnership starts with one campus done well. That is how ours started too.
